Ludhiana: Punjab’s beekeeping industry is on the brink of collapse as a “perfect storm” of erratic weather, punitive US tariffs, and rampant honey adulteration forces veteran apiarists to abandon the trade.Production has plummeted this season, with beekeepers reporting yields of just 18-20 kg from each hive, down from the traditional average of 35kg.
